The Jason Bishop Show coming to Freed Center stage
Ohio Northern University’s Freed Center for the Performing Arts will present “The Jason Bishop Show” on Saturday, Jan. 23, at 4 p.m.
Bishop is an international award-winning illusionist who was the youngest person to win the Magician’s Alliance of Eastern States Stage Award and one of the youngest people to compete in the Society of American Magicians World-Class competition.
From his breathtaking double levitation to his cutting edge op-art and plasma illusions, Bishop features stunning and original state-of-the-art magic.
One thing that distinguishes Bishop is his virtuosity. Each show features award-winning sleight of hand, exclusive grand illusions and close-up magic projected onto a large movie screen. No other illusionist showcases such a diverse array of talents.
Additionally, the show is delivered with a modern energy and an outstanding rock and pop soundtrack. Bishop cuts through the usual hype and focuses on entertaining audiences with one remarkable illusion after another. Each routine is presented in his unique style. Some pieces feature more laughs than expected from an illusionist, while others demonstrate sleight-of-hand skill performed at a world-class level.
